Synthesis and characterisation of new oligoacetylenic silanes

Abstract

Synthetic routes to a series of novel oligoacetylenic silanes with or without (hetero)aromatic bridges have been developed. The compound Me3SiC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SiMe3 was first prepared, which was selectively desilylated with CaCO3 in methanol at room temperature to afford the mono-protected bis(alkynyl) silane Me3SiC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CH in moderate yield. Treatment of this mono-protected species with nBuLi, followed by silylation with Ph2SiCl2, gives a good yield of Me3SiC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SiMe3, with alternating silicon and acetylene units. A range of linear silicon-linked oligoalkynes containing phenylene, bithienylene and anthrylene rings, HC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CH and HC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CH (R = 1,4-phenylene, 5,5′-bithienylene or 9,10-anthrylene), were synthesised by condensation reactions of Ph2SiCl2 with the components obtained in situ from a HC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CRC[triple bond, length half m-dash]CH–nBuLi mixture in THF and the products were isolated by chromatography on silica. All these new compounds have been characterised by IR, 1H and 13C NMR and UV/VIS spectroscopies and mass spectrometry. The single-crystal X-ray structure of HC[triple bond, length half m-dash]C(p-C6H4)C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]C(p-C6H4)C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CSi(Ph)2C[triple bond, length half m-dash]C(p-C6H4)C[triple bond, length half m-dash]CH has been determined, showing that two silicon atoms and six acetylene units constitute the backbone of the molecule.
